Abstract:
Agriculture employs 1.3 billion people throughout the world. Changes to working conditions in agriculture are investigated by several disciplines that explore different themes. These themes are summarized here through two areas: one that focuses on the worker (employment, health and skills) and the other on work as a component of farming systems. The analytical frameworks and core research issues are described. This paper is designed to be a general introduction to the special issue of Cahiers Agricultures, entitled "Multifacet realities of work in agriculture".
